Cozy comfort. When dining here, you forget you're in a "pub." It is comfortable and dark. Great menu. sandwiches, ribs, appetizers, chicken potpie all delicious. The only thing on the menu I didn't like was the French onion soup. It has a lighter broth and just wasn't what Im used to. Anyway, overall great place and they have a lovely outdoor dining area with a fountain as well. Service can be a little slow on the weekends.

This is one of the best places in Bay Ridge.. The food is awesome in a comfort food kinda way. From the creamy to die for mashed potatoes to the amazing spare ribs to the entrees which are never too complicated but always hearty. The atmosphere is cozy and the staff are fun and friendly. The crowd is always diverse and the music is usually good. Its the kind of place a single girl can hang out without feeling vulnerable! Check it out!

FAR FROM CHEERIE. I've been stopping in for a Burger/Beer a few times a year for the past 15 years when I visit my sister who moved around the block from the place. The look and ambiance is nice, it has an old world style bar. The beer is fresh and the burgers are average but not great. I suppose it?s slightly better than a standard Diner burger, although some Diners have much better burgers. The burger comes in an English Muffin bun that?s ok but it's a matter of preference, it can be a little too greasy. I?ve known the place for a while and have seen a general decline over time. In the past some nice local women would come in, but for some reason they stopped coming around years ago. The nice feeling the ambiance gave you quickly changes when you settle in and try to get service. It is generally not a friendly place, unless you're maybe one of the 15 or so local regulars who live around the bar. The place is very cliquish and is reduced to mostly unhappy disability collecting ex-civil servant/union worker types. Be prepared to be ignored for a while even when they?re not busy. The staff is usually caught up in important conversation or suffering from ADD so don't expect much and you?ll be fine, they will eventually get to you. If you wanted to show an out-of-town friend what Bayridge was like and took them here you?d be doing a disservice to the people here and to your friend. Not recommended and not what it used to be.

Great Decor Great Food. One of the best things that I like about Skinflints is the decor. Its has real cozy "old world" feel. There are many antiques, statues and great paintings. I particularly like the 4 "monkey lamps" on the bar. Skinflints is a great place for having a few drinks, eating at the bar, or sitting at a table. In the summer time they even have outdoor seating. I highly recommend however on the weekends be prepared to wait to be seated . Rumor has it that Jerry Garcia played at skinflints back inthe 1960's when it was a biker bar.
